I think the answer is because none of the DeLorean mechanics are
close to Orlando. I do know that Universal in Los Angeles rejected
an offer by D1 to fix up their cars. I also believe that Don Steger
may have restored them a few years ago, but I'm not sure. I've
heard that the DeLorean Owners Association offers to clean up some
cars from time to time, especially in museums. Suprisingly, these
offers are often declined. Everybody knows better, I guess.

> I was in Orlando at the BTTF ride in Universal and was extremely
dissapointed at the condition of the display car. I understand that
is sits outside 24/7 but the front and rear bumpers were cracked,
unpainted and patched, the stainless was spotted and not clean, the
interior dash had cracks in it, the wheels were unpainted and
peeling, etc. It did not seem to be part of the display, but just
neglected. Please correct me if I am wrong.
>
> I was also walking through the California's Fisherman's wharf
portion of the park and saw a sign that said the boats that were
used and on display were maintained by Pro Line and Donzi. Then it
came to me...
>
> ...why doesn't DMC Houston, Specialty Auto, DeLorean One, PJ
Grady, NWDMC, or even the DeLorean Owner's Assoc. or local club(s)
donate their time and probably no more than $500 to "spruce and
clean up" the Delorean? This would probably only need to be done
every other year or so. After all, this is a representation of
us. Plus based on the boat display, whoever cleans it would
probably be allowed to put their WEB address and name on the car.
What Great Exposure from a business standpoint!!!!
